Overlay 96
. STAT DCH
Tasks
- Verify all D Channels operational
- Troubleshoot/escalate any issues with D Channels
- If Telecom Analyst determines D Channel is no longer in production, schedule for de-configuration of all related programming.
. PLOG DCH x
Tasks
- Print D Channel log for each D Channel
- Review counter legend (below) and be aware of any ongoing protocol issues.
. STAT MSDL . STAT MSDL x FULL
Tasks
- Stat each MSDL individually, identify any disabled MSDL ports
- Troubleshoot/escalate disabled MSDL ports
. STAT TMDI . STAT TMDI x FULL
Tasks
- Stat each TMDI individually, identify any disabled TMDI ports
- Troubleshoot/escalate disabled TMDI ports
| Protocol counters | |
|---|---|
| 1 | count of missing PRI handshakes |
| 2 | count of peer-initiated re-establishment link |
| 3 | count of unsuccessful retransmit N200 of SABME |
| 4 | count of unsuccessful retransmit N200 of DISC |
| 5 | count of N(R) errors |
| 6 | count of information fields with length greater than N201 |
| 7 | count of undefined frames |
| 8 | count of information fields that are not allowed to contain information |
| 9 | count of FRMR frames received from the far end |
| 10 | count of CRC error frames received from the far end |
| 11 | count of REJ frames received from the far end |
| 12 | count of layer 3 messages with less than 4 octets |
| 13 | dummy counter, always zero |
| 14 | count of undefined layer 3 message types |
| 15 | count of layer 3 messages missing one or more mandatory information elements |
| 16 | count of layer 3 messages missing one or more undefined information elements |
| 17 | count of layer 1 reports of no external clock being received |
| 18 | count of aborted frames |
| 19 | count of SABME frames received with incorrect C/R bit |
| 20 | count of supervisory frames received with F = 1 |
| 21 | count of unsolicited DM responses with F = 1 |
| 22 | count of unsolicited UA responses with F = 1 |
| 23 | count of unsolicited UA responses with F = 0 |
| 24 | count of DM responses with F = 0 |
| 25 | count of times that no response was received from the far end after N200 transmissions retransmissions of RR or RNR |
| 26 | count of frames received with incorrect header length |
| 27 | number of times owner receiver busy condition was entered |
| 28 | number of times peer receiver busy condition was entered |
| 29 | count of messages with call reference length greater than 2 |
| 30 | count of optional IEs received with invalid contents |
| 31 | count of mandatory IEs received with invalid contents |
| 32 | count of messages received with IEs not ordered correctly |
| 33 | count of IEs which were repeated in received messages, but are only allowed to appear once per message |
| 34 | count of IEs received with length exceeding the specified maximum length for the IE |
| 35 | count of layer 3 messages from far end with invalid call reference flag value of 0 |
| 36 | count of layer 3 messages from far end with invalid call reference flag value of 1 |
| 37 | count of layer 3 messages from far end with invalid global call reference |
| 38 | count of layer 3 messages from system that are too short |
| 39 | count of layer 3 messages from system containing an undefined message type |
| 40 | count of layer 3 messages from system missing mandatory IE(s) |
| 41 | count of layer 3 messages from system containing unsupported IE(s) |
| 42 | count of layer 3 messages from system containing invalid operational IE(s) |
| 43 | count of layer 3 messages from system containing invalid mandatory IE(s) |
| 44 | count of layer 3 messages from system with IE(s) out of order |
| 45 | count of layer 3 messages from system containing repeated IE(s) |
| 46 | count of layer 3 messages from far end with an invalid call reference length |
| 47 | count of layer 3 messages from system with an invalid call reference flag value of 0 |
| 48 | count of layer 3 messages from system with an invalid call reference flag value of 1 |
| 49 | count of layer 3 messages from system with an invalid global call reference |
| 50 | count of unexpected layer 3 messages received from the far end |
| 51 | count of unexpected layer 3 messages received from the system |
| 52 | count of unexpected layer 3 timer expirations |
| 53 | count of protocol messages received when D-channel is not in service or waiting for a Service Acknowledge message |
